Good to Know
Manitoba Harvest and Bob's Red Mill both sell hulled hemp seeds (sometimes labeled hemp hearts) that are pure seed with nothing added, so a quick scan of the ingredient list should show one item. Toss 3 tablespoons over a salad or stir them into full-fat Greek yogurt for an easy 9.5g of protein without cooking. Pre-flavored varieties can sneak in dried fruit or sweeteners, which pushes the net carbs above the 1.4g you get from plain seeds.
Is Hemp Seeds (Hulled) Keto? The Full Answer
Hemp Seeds contains 1.40g net carbs per 3 tablespoons (2.60g total carbs minus 1.20g fiber). 1.4g net carbs. Complete protein with ideal omega-3:6 ratio.
On a standard ketogenic diet, most people target 20-25g net carbs per day. A single serving uses 7% of a 20g daily carb limit. That makes Hemp Seeds a reliable keto staple.
Measure Your Ketone Levels
A blood ketone meter reads beta-hydroxybutyrate from a finger prick, the marker that defines nutritional ketosis at 0.5 to 3.0 mmol/L. Urine strips measure acetoacetate instead, which drops off once you are fat-adapted. Keto-Mojo makes a blood meter.
